Project/Account Management Placement

As a Project Management Assistant or Account Management Assistant, you’ll be involved in all aspects of the business – ranging from Sales and Project Management, to Customer Service and Consultancy. You’ll be assisting either our Senior Account Manager or Premium Services Director and their assigned customer base, ensuring their success long-term and assisting them with strategic discussions and customer journey planning. Being at the forefront of our fast-paced Premium Services team, this role requires an ambitious, customer-focused individual, who has a drive for success; it will be down to you to be a Prospect Ambassador!

The key focus for these roles will be to grow and nurture customer relationships to guarantee customer retention. Whether it be managing a project, or consulting with customers during the Onboarding process, you’ll be constantly establishing new relationships and building customer rapport. You’ll also gain real insight and understanding into business processes through interacting with customers daily.

If you can listen to our customers to guide them to the right solution and help them overcome their business challenges, then you’re the person we are looking for!

Some of the things you’ll be doing:

  • Project Management – Delivering software solutions is a core part of the business. In these roles, you’ll be playing a crucial part by scoping and documenting requirements to support customer and internal projects. Managing these tasks will require impeccable organisation skills to ensure you successfully manage and meet desired timescales and internal deadlines. Effectively liaising and co-ordinating with team members across departments, and most importantly, the customer, is crucial to ensure a successful outcome.
  • Delivery of Consultancy Services – Partnering with our highly experienced Consultants, Trainers and Developers, you’ll be part of a team delivering real business benefit to our customers. Assist with both strategic & tactical reviews with customers ensuring all discussed items are logged and possible projects are tracked.
  • Co-ordinating Resources – Having the right people doing the right work at the right time is a key part of delivering a successful and cost-effective project – right from project inception through each stage of the project to final handover.
  • Working as a Team – Serve as a primary point of contact for either the Senior Account Manager or Premium Services Director. Work as part of the Premium Services team to help customers & support your colleagues.
  • Building Customer Rapport – Each element of the role is strongly focused on communicating with our customer base. Having the ability to build relationships and trust with customers is a vital skill you’ll adopt.
  • Customer Service – At ProspectSoft, we pride ourselves on exceptional customer service, and every member of staff contributes to this. This will involve providing timely answers and assistance in a professional and friendly manner that reflects the company's core values.
  • Business Development – A key part of this role is to be able to identify business development opportunities that would add further value to the customer’s solution. You’ll help our customers get the most benefit out of the system.
  • Software Demonstrations – As the year progresses, you’ll confidently demonstrate our software to customers. Understanding customer requirements is an essential part of delivering high quality, relevant demonstrations in a persuasive manner.

About ProspectSoft

We're a UK-based Division of The Access Group, specialising in CRM & eCommerce, headed up by our original founder. We create, develop and deliver our SaaS platform, Prospect, to more than 5,000 SME users worldwide. Prospect is perfect for businesses who sell physical products from stock B2B. As the official “Stock Aware CRM”, Prospect offers native integration to leading accounting and inventory management systems like Sage 50, Unleashed and Xero.
